Overview

This fourth edition of Fundamentals of Research Methodology for Healthcare Professionals has been updated to incorporate the latest trends in research methodology and evidence-based practice. It details the steps involved in planning and undertaking a research project, from identifying and formulating the problem through to reporting findings. It underscores the importance of having a clear understanding of research methodology and terminology for doing the following: reading research reports with critical insight, implementing evidence-based prac¬tice, and expanding research. This edition is certain to stimulate awareness of the myriad researchable and research-requiring questions encountered daily in healthcare practice. Key features include: - clearly defined learning objectives to indicate the focus of each chapter - practical examples of research projects or steps in the research process - chapter summaries to reinforce learning - exercises to put the theory into practice - a practical, hands-on introduction to research methodology.

Table of Contents

Contents; Chapter 1: Orientation to health sciences research; Chapter 2: Research and theory; Chapter 3: Ethical considerations in the conduct of health sciences research; Chapter 4: An overview of the research process; Chapter 5: Selecting or identifying research problems; Chapter 6: The literature review; Chapter 7: Refining and defining the research question or formulating a hypothesis and preparing a research proposal; Chapter 8: Quantitative research; Chapter 9: Qualitative research designs; Chapter 10: Sampling; Chapter 11: Data collection; Chapter 12: Data quality; Chapter 13: Data analysis; Chapter 14: Research reports and report evaluation.
